
body {  text-align:center;  font-family: georgia,helvetica,arial, Serif;font-size:100%;background: #ffffff url(../images/grass.jpg) repeat;}
#frame {  width:751px !important;  margin-top:0px; text-align:left;margin:0 auto;}
#frame img {border:0;}
#top {  width: 751px;height:13px;  background: url(../images/header.jpg) no-repeat; padding:0 0 0 0px;  margin: 0px;text-align:center;}
#footer {  width: 751px;height:13px;  background: url(../images/footer.jpg) no-repeat;  padding: 0px 0 0 0 ;  margin: 0 0 10px 0px;clear:left;}
#main {  float: left;  width: 751px;  background: #ffffff;padding:0 0px 0px 0px;margin:0;}
#copyright {  width: 751px;height:32px;  background: url(../images/copyright.jpg) no-repeat;  padding: 0px 0 0 0 ;  margin: 0 0 0 0px;clear:left;}
#banner {  width: 707px;height:123px;  background: url(../images/headerbanner.jpg) no-repeat; padding:0 0 30px 0px;  margin: auto;}
.menuu	ul	{	list-style-type:none; padding: 0px 0 0 0 ;  margin: 0 0 0 0px;background:#ffffff;}
.menuu	li	{	padding:2px 3px 0 3px;	background:none;	}
.menuu ul li a.menu:link,
.menuu ul li a.menu:visited,
.menuu ul li a.menu:active	{color:#ffffff;display: block;background-image: url(../images/menubg.jpg);font-size:70%;width: 174px;height:24px;padding:10px 0 0 10px;text-decoration:none;}
.menuu ul li a.menu:hover	{color:#000000;display: block;background-image: url(../images/menubgover.jpg);font-size:70%;width: 174px;height:24px;padding:10px 0 0 10px;text-decoration:none;margin:0 0 0 0;}
.address	ul	{list-style-type:none; padding: 70px 0 20px 0 ;  margin:3px 0 20px 0px;background:#3D7BB8;width: 175px;background-image: url(../images/blueboxbottom.jpg);background-repeat: no-repeat;background-position:  bottom; }
.address	li	{	padding:2px 3px 0 10px;	background:none;	color:#ffffff;font-size:70%;}
#leftcontent {  float: left;  width: 174px; padding: 0px;  margin:0 30px 0 17px;}



a:link, a:active, a:visited {color: #3D7BB8;	text-decoration: none;border-bottom:1px #3D7BB8 dotted; font-weight: bold;}
a:hover {color: #333333;text-decoration: none;border-bottom:1px #333333 dotted; }

#rightcontent {  float: left;  width: 460px;  background: #fff;  padding: 10px;  margin:0px;}
#rightcontent li{font-size: 75%;color: #3D7BB8;font-weight:bold;line-height:30px;}
h1.welcome{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/welcome.jpg) no-repeat;width: 354px;height: 42px;}
h1.contact{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/contact.jpg) no-repeat;width: 354px;height: 42px;}
h1.sponsorship{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/sponsorship.jpg) no-repeat;width: 354px;height: 42px;}
h1.juniors{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/juniors.jpg) no-repeat;width: 354px;height: 42px;}
h1.pavilion{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/pavilion.jpg) no-repeat;width: 354px;height: 42px;}
h1.news{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/news.jpg) no-repeat;width: 354px;height: 42px;}
h1.history{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/history.jpg) no-repeat;width: 354px;height: 42px;}
h1.six{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/six.jpg) no-repeat;width: 354px;height: 42px;}
h1.gallery{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/gallery.jpg) no-repeat;width: 354px;height: 42px;}
h1.terms{	font-size: 0px;	color: #fff;	line-height: 1.6em;background: url(../images/terms.jpg) no-repeat;width: 354px;height: 42px;}




h2 {color: #666666;	font-size: 80%;	font-weight:bold;margin-bottom:20px;margin-top:20px;padding-left:1px;}
h3 {color: #cccccc;	font-size: 80%;	font-weight:bold;margin-bottom:20px;margin-top:20px;padding-left:50px;text-align:left;}

.righttestimonials {float:left; background:#B1CAE3;width:160px;padding:20px;margin-right:20px;margin-bottom:25px;}
.righttestimonials p {font-size:14px;font-weight:bold;margin-bottom:0;}
.righttestimonials span {color:#4B6A28;font-size:11px;margin-top:22px;} 

p{font-size:75%;line-height:24px;color:#333333;margin-bottom:30px;}



.copyrightleft 		{float: left;  width: 330px; padding: 0px;  margin:0px 60px 0px 11px;}
.copyrightright 	{float: left;  width: 280px;  background: transparent;  padding: 0px;  margin:0px 0 0px 0px;}
.copyrightright	ul, .copyrightleft	ul	{	list-style-type:none; padding: 0px 0 0 0 ;  margin: 0 0 0 0px;}
.copyrightright	li, .copyrightleft	li	{	padding:0px 3px 0 3px;	background:none;	display:inline;font-size:60%;line-height:3.6em;}


#rightcontent img {float:left;padding-left:30px;padding-bottom:20px;}
#rightcontent .gallery img {float:none;padding-left:0px;padding-bottom:0px;border:0;}
#rightcontent .gallery a:link {border:0;}

#rightcontent img.front {float:left;padding-left:0px;padding-bottom:20px;}


h2.newsheader {color: #3D7BB8;	font-size: 150%;	font-weight:bold;margin: 0 0 0 0px;padding-left:1px;}
h3.newsdate {color: #B1CAE3;	font-size: 80%;	font-weight:bold;margin:0 0 0 0px;padding-left:1px;text-align:left;}



.sponsors {  float: left;  width: 751px;  background: #ffffff;padding:30px 0px 30px 0px;margin:0;text-align:center;}
.sponsors   hr {color: #cccccc;height:1px;margin-left:30px;margin-right:30px;}
.sponsors  hr {border-width: 1px; border-style: solid; border-color: #cccccc}
.sponsors h1 {color:red;}
.sponsors ul {	list-style-type:none; padding: 0px 0 0 0 ;  margin: 0 0 0 0px;display:inline;}
.sponsors	ul li	{	padding:0px 0px 0 0px;	background:none;	display:inline !important;font-size:60%;}

.sponsors ul li a.mill:link,
.sponsors ul li a.mill:active,
.sponsors ul li a.mill:visited	{margin-left:35px;float:left;color:#ffffff;display: block;background-image: url(../images/mill.jpg);font-size:1%;width: 95px;height:70px;padding:0px 0 0 0px;text-decoration:none;border:0;}
.sponsors ul li a.mill:hover	{margin-left:35px;float:left;color:#ffffff;display: block;background-image: url(../images/mill_over.jpg);font-size:1%;width: 95px;height:70px;padding:0px 0 0 0px;text-decoration:none;}


.sponsors ul li a.slink:link,
.sponsors ul li a.slink:active,
.sponsors ul li a.slink:visited	{margin-left:50px;margin-top:2px;float:left;color:#ffffff;display: block;background-image: url(../images/slinky.jpg);font-size:1%;width: 140px;height:66px;padding:0px 0 0 0px;text-decoration:none;border:0;}
.sponsors ul li a.slink:hover	{float:left;color:#ffffff;display: block;background-image: url(../images/slinky_over.jpg);font-size:1%;width: 140px;height:66px;padding:0px 0 0 0px;text-decoration:none;margin-left:50px;}

.sponsors ul li a.petrol:link,
.sponsors ul li a.petrol:active,
.sponsors ul li a.petrol:visited	{margin-left:50px;margin-top:7px;float:left;color:#ffffff;display: block;background-image: url(../images/pinkpetrol.jpg);font-size:1%;width: 155px;height:56px;padding:0px 0 0 0px;text-decoration:none;border:0;}
.sponsors ul li a.petrol:hover	{float:left;margin-top:7px;color:#ffffff;display: block;background-image: url(../images/pinkpetrol_over.jpg);font-size:1%;width: 155px;height:56px;padding:0px 0 0 0px;text-decoration:none;margin-left:50px;}

.sponsors ul li a.trevor:link,
.sponsors ul li a.trevor:active,
.sponsors ul li a.trevor:visited	{margin-left:30px;margin-top:10px;float:left;color:#ffffff;display: block;background-image: url(../images/trevorjones.jpg);font-size:1%;width: 155px;height:51px;padding:0px 0 0 0px;text-decoration:none;border:0;}
.sponsors ul li a.trevor:hover	{margin-top:10px;float:left;color:#ffffff;display: block;background-image: url(../images/trevorjones_over.jpg);font-size:1%;width: 155px;height:51px;padding:0px 0 0 0px;text-decoration:none;margin-left:30px;}


.sponsorssub h3 {text-align:left !important;padding:0;margin:0;font-size:70%;}
.sponsorssub {text-align:left;padding:0;margin:0;width: 120px;}
.sponsorssub	ul	{list-style-type:none; padding: 20px 0 0px 0 ;  margin:0px 0 0px 0px;background:#fff;width: 87px;background-repeat: no-repeat;background-position:  bottom; }
.sponsorssub	li	{text-align:left;	padding:0px 0px 0 0px;	background:none;	color:#ffffff;font-size:70%;width: 87px;}

a.club:link,
a.club:active,
a.club:visited	{margin-left:30px;margin-top:0px;float:left;color:#ffffff;display: block;background-image: url(../images/clubmarkBW.jpg);font-size:1%;width: 87px;height:87px;padding:0px 0 0 0px;text-decoration:none;border:0;}
a.club:hover	{margin-top:0px;float:left;color:#ffffff;display: block;background-image: url(../images/clubmark_color.jpg);font-size:1%;width: 87px;height:87px;padding:0px 0 0 0px;text-decoration:none;margin-left:30px;}